MPX5067492: Fashion 1960's. Grannys swimsuit surfaces again. In grandma's day, the outfit on the left would have been looked on as daring, no doubt. Such a saucy display of knee. But on Thursday (28-9-67), half a century or so later, it cropped up again - at a swimwear show in London. Which is fine, if sunburned knees are all you want. Otherwise, thankfully, the bikini is still there. The brief bikini - covered in black and white sequins - costs £12.12s. The other bathing outfit - consisting of several yards of towelling - is only £6.16s. 6d. Both are by Trend Swimwear. September 1967 P017086 / Bridgeman Images
MPX5067519: Atten-Shun! His Grace the Duke of Atholl, has his very own private army, the Atholl Highlanders. The Duke, commander of the Highlanders, the only private army in Europe musters his forces before marching into action. Not, sad to say, against some robber baron or upstart knight. Instead the target was the capture of more tourists for the Duke's Perthshire castle, Scotland. And it was mission accomplished as hundreds of spectators crowded the lawns to watch the Highlanders being reviewed by their commandant. As the tourists went off to tour the castle as 3s 6d a time, the Highlanders collected their pay - a whisky. The line-up of the Atholl Highlanders in front of Blair Castle and being inspected by the Duke of Atholl. The 36-year-old Duke holds the parade of his private army every year. / Bridgeman Images

MPX5071288: Sport: The South African springbok rugby team that flew in yesterday to be welcomed by anti-apartheid demonstrators at London Airport were shouted at and had banners waved in their faces during their practice session at the Richmond Athletic Association ground at Richmond this morning. The demonstrators were escorted from the ground by the police. The springbok players pictured during training this morning. October 1969 / Bridgeman Images
